Job Title: Senior Gender Integration and Mainstreaming Associate

Job Description

Responsibilities

  • Provide technical assistance to health facilities to ensure provision and documentation of post-gender-based violence care in line with the PEPFAR/WHO minimum package
  • Facilitate “needs based” capacity building activities for gender champions both at facility and community levels on gender integration including first line support and the implementation of clinical pathway for treatment of sexual assault survivors
  • Work with health facilities and CBOs to establish and strengthen referral mechanism and linkages between clinical and non-clinical post GBV care service provision;
  • Assist in the monitoring and evaluation of GBV data and program performance, sharing reports on progress on a monthly basis
  • Support quarterly assessment of post-GBV services in supported facilities using the GBV quality assurance tool and provide technical assistance to ensure quality improvement
  • Provide regular supportive supervision to supported health facilities/CBOs to ensure the achievement of expected results;
  • Coordinate activities to commemorate international days (such as orange the world, international women’s day etc.) as a platform to provide GBV sensitization and support gender equality
  • Conduct desk review on gender and health policies in Nigeria and support in the conduct of gender analysis to inform program interventions and implementation
  • Foster partnerships with government stakeholders for sustainability of GBV interventions and safe placements for GBV survivors
  • Create and disseminate tools, frameworks and resources to support gender integration into existing HIV prevention, care and treatment services across supported facilities and communities
  • Document successes and lessons learnt that highlight the Project’s gender integration/equality programming.

Qualifications

  • University Degree (or higher) in Social Sciences (i.e. Sociology, Psychology), Public Health, Child Health, International Development, or in an area relevant to Gender, Health, and HIV/AIDs
  • At least 3 years’ post NYSC work experience including at least 3-4 years implementing gender-based interventions in a similar setting
  • Experience in implementing gender services in the context of HIV and knowledge of CDC minimum package of services for gender-based violence survivors
  • Demonstrated ability to ensure gender integration in project design, implementation, monitoring and evaluation
  • Evidence of capacity to support implementation of gender norms re-orientation and links with HIV/ AIDS
  • Excellent conceptual, analytical, writing and oral communication and facilitation skills
  • Team playing qualities/experience
  • Sensitivity to cultures and social systems, and genuine interest in capacity building responses to development issues.
  • Ability to navigate culturally sensitive terrain and maintain constructive relationships with a diverse set of key stakeholders.
